The future of AI — whether in training or evaluation, classical ML or agentic workflows — starts with high-quality data.

At HumanSignal, we’re building the platform that powers the creation, curation, and evaluation of that data. From fine-tuning foundation models to validating agent behaviors in production, our tools are used by leading AI teams to ensure models are grounded in real-world signal, not noise.

Our open-source product, Label Studio, has become the de facto standard for labeling and evaluating data across modalities — from text and images to time series and agents-in-environments. With over 250,000 users and hundreds of millions of labeled samples, it’s the most widely adopted OSS solution for teams working on building AI systems. 

Label Studio Enterprise builds on that traction with the security, collaboration, and scalability features needed to support mission-critical AI pipelines — powering everything from model training datasets to eval test sets to continuous feedback loops.We started before foundation models were mainstream, and we’re doubling down now that AI is eating the world. Software Engineering Expert - Code Annotation & Evaluation SpecialistAbout the Role

HumanSignal is seeking highly qualified software engineering and computer science experts to contribute to cutting-edge AI development projects. This role involves evaluating, annotating, and validating code across multiple programming languages and domains to improve AI model performance in software development and problem-solving.

Compensation

Up to $110 USD/hour based on qualifications and project complexity

Required QualificationsEducation
  • Master's degree required in a computer science or software engineering-related field
  • PhD strongly preferred in:
    • Computer Science
    • Software Engineering
    • Computer Engineering
    • Computational Science
    • Information Science
    • Or closely related technical disciplines
Degree Field Requirements

Candidates must hold degrees directly in computer science, software engineering, or computationally-intensive fields. Acceptable programs include:

  • Computer Science
  • Software Engineering
  • Computer Engineering
  • Computational Science
  • Information Technology (with strong programming foundation)
  • Data Science/Machine Learning
  • Electrical Engineering (with software emphasis)
Responsibilities
  • Review and evaluate code for correctness, efficiency, and best practices
  • Annotate code logic, algorithms, and implementation approaches
  • Validate AI-generated code across various programming languages and frameworks
  • Identify bugs, security vulnerabilities, and performance issues
  • Provide detailed feedback on code quality, structure, and documentation
  • Work with problems spanning algorithms, data structures, system design, and software architecture
Qualifications
  • Deep understanding of software engineering principles across multiple domains
  • Proficiency in multiple programming languages
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Excellent attention to detail and code quality standards
  • Ability to clearly articulate technical reasoning and trade-offs
  • Experience with version control, testing frameworks, and development tools
  • Familiarity with software development methodologies
  • Ability to work independently and meet deadlines
Work Details
  • Flexible, project-based work - work on your own schedule
  • Remote position - work from anywhere
  • Variable hours based on project availability and your capacity
  • Ongoing training and calibration provided
  • Quality-focused environment with performance feedback
Ideal Candidate Profile
  • Active software engineers, researchers, professors, or recent graduates in CS/engineering fields
  • Strong GitHub/portfolio or demonstrated technical expertise
  • Experience in software development, research, or industry applications
  • Passion for advancing AI capabilities in software development domains
How to Apply

Interested candidates should be prepared to:

  1. Submit CV/resume highlighting technical qualifications
  2. Provide proof of advanced degree(s)
  3. Complete a brief coding assessment
  4. Participate in a qualification review

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
